West Hills College Coalinga

 

  West Hills College Coalinga

The West Hills Community College was established as a college for the Coalinga Union High School District in 1932. It is a public, two-year community college, and one of the 12 California community colleges. The Coalinga campus was built in 1932 and today offers enrollment to more than 1,000 students, while the Lemoore campus was established in 2002 and now serves more than 3,000 students every semester. In addition to these two campuses, WHC also offers classes in other centers:

  • Naval Air Station Lemoore
  • NDC Firebaugh - Library and Learning Resource Center

WHC offers a number of degrees and certificates in various Course Topics like administration of justice, art, business, biology, chemistry, computer information systems, child development, geography, health science, mathematics, liberal arts and teaching. Online courses in administration of justice, liberal arts, psychology and social science are also available through WHC.

Coalinga campus'athletic teams participate in football, basketball, volleyball, softball and rodeo. The Lemoore campus sponsors teams in soccer, golf, cross country and wrestling.

Profile of West Hills College Coalinga

West Hills College Coalinga is located in a self-contained town, in Coalinga, CA. The school is a public institution. Degree levels at West Hills College Coalinga top out at the Associate's degree.

Course Topics

Students at the school often study office and administration, family and social work, security and law enforcement, and liberal arts.

West Hills College Coalinga Selectivity

West Hills College Coalinga maintains an open-admission policy. It's not unusual for students to find their classmates include those from other parts of the country.

Faculty

The school's tenure system is geared toward rewarding and keeping the most valuable professors. By paying its faculty better than most schools, the school tries to attract and retain a high quality teaching staff.

Student Enrollment

West Hills College Coalinga offers classes to 2,833 students (1,622 full-time equivalent). Minorities are common at the school.

Student Life

Many students live in housing on or near campus. The school does offer meal plans to students.

West Hills College Coalinga Tuition and Affordability

Tuition is fairly low at West Hills College Coalinga.
